I've written before that a 26% compounding daily rate means we are doubling every 3 days. Oz has been close to that 26%, but just under the last 6 days or so before today.

1072 cases end of last night x 1.26 = 1350. https://twitter.com/COVID_Australia has the current count at 1,316 as at 2.30pm.

Yesterday that twitter site were reporting 45 people have recovered today reporting 69. That's going up the right way.

ttps://www.abc.net.au/news/2020-03-22/wa-sa-set-to-close-borders-amid-coronavirus-fight/12079044

Declaring a "major emergency", authorities in Western Australia and South Australia have announced tough new measures that will see both states close their borders to slow the spread of coronavirus.

And just on that AFL announcement - we’ve just heard that the 2020 season has been postponed. Clubs have just received the news from AFL.

The suspension is expected to last until at least May 31. It includes AFLW.
